英英释义

complement

[ \'kɔmplə,mentid ]

n.

a word or phrase used to complete a grammatical construction

a complete number or quantity

\"a full complement\"

number needed to make up a whole force

\"a full complement of workers\"

同义词:full complement

something added to complete or make perfect

\"a fine wine is a perfect complement to the dinner\"

one of a series of enzymes in the blood serum that are part of the immune response

either of two parts that mutually complete each other

v.

make complete or perfect; supply what is wanting or form the complement to

\"I need some pepper to complement the sweet touch in the soup\"
